Dynamically chose fee for TxRedeem.
Alice chooses the fee for TxRedeem because she is the one that cares. Note must be taken here because if the fee is too low (e.g. < min tx fee) then she might not be able to publish TxRedeem at all.

use crate::{bitcoin, monero};
use conquer_once::Lazy;
use ecdsa_fun::fun::marker::Mark;
use serde::{Deserialize, Serialize};
use sha2::Sha256;
use sigma_fun::ext::dl_secp256k1_ed25519_eq::{CrossCurveDLEQ, CrossCurveDLEQProof};
use sigma_fun::HashTranscript;
use uuid::Uuid;
pub mod alice;
pub mod bob;
pub static CROSS_CURVE_PROOF_SYSTEM: Lazy<
CrossCurveDLEQ<HashTranscript<Sha256, rand_chacha::ChaCha20Rng>>,
> = Lazy::new(|| {
CrossCurveDLEQ::<HashTranscript<Sha256, rand_chacha::ChaCha20Rng>>::new(
(*ecdsa_fun::fun::G).mark::<ecdsa_fun::fun::marker::Normal>(),
curve25519_dalek::constants::ED25519_BASEPOINT_POINT,
)
});
#[derive(Clone,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
pub struct Message0 {
swap_id: Uuid,
B: bitcoin::PublicKey,
S_b_monero: monero::PublicKey,
S_b_bitcoin: bitcoin::PublicKey,
dleq_proof_s_b: CrossCurveDLEQProof,
v_b: monero::PrivateViewKey,
refund_address: bitcoin::Address,
}
#[derive(Clone,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
pub struct Message1 {
A: bitcoin::PublicKey,
S_a_monero: monero::PublicKey,
S_a_bitcoin: bitcoin::PublicKey,
dleq_proof_s_a: CrossCurveDLEQProof,
v_a: monero::PrivateViewKey,
redeem_address: bitcoin::Address,
punish_address: bitcoin::Address,
#[serde(with = "::bitcoin::util::amount::serde::as_sat")]
tx_redeem_fee: bitcoin::Amount,
}
#[derive(Clone,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
pub struct Message2 {
psbt: bitcoin::PartiallySignedTransaction,
}
#[derive(Clone,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
pub struct Message3 {
tx_cancel_sig: bitcoin::Signature,
tx_refund_encsig: bitcoin::EncryptedSignature,
}
#[derive(Clone, Debug, Serialize, Deserialize)]
pub struct Message4 {
tx_punish_sig: bitcoin::Signature,
tx_cancel_sig: bitcoin::Signature,
}
